TPG Seismically Shifts the Mobile Cap Plan Market

TPG has taken Australia's most popular mobile cap plan, a $49 cap with generally around $300 of included value, and changed the price point to an unprecedented $19.99 per month.

Sydney, NSW (PRWEB) August 23, 2008 -- TPG, Australia's best value broadband provider, this week released an exceptional mobile offer with the $19.99 Mobile Cap Saver plan.

The company has taken Australia's most popular mobile cap plan, a $49 cap with generally around $300 of included value, and changed the price point to an unprecedented $19.99 per month.

"We are giving customers exceptional value with the $19.99 Mobile Cap Saver plan. We have moved the typical contract period to 12 months which allows for great flexibility. We allow customers to supply their own handsets or buy handsets at super cheap prices from us that can be used with our plan," said Craig Levy, TPG's Mobile Division General Manager.

"A customer with any of the $49 Cap plans available in the market today can stop paying $49 a month, start paying $19.99 a month with TPG and still get their $300 of included value which can be used for calls, text and data," said Mr Levy. "The TPG Cap Saver Plan also comes with free 20 minute calls to TPG, Soul and Optus mobiles between 8pm and midnight every day.

"There aren't any catches," Mr Levy continued. "The call rates are comparable to $49 cap plans already in the market, and the eligible call types are similar in range."

"We believe that savings of this kind will be very important for consumers in these difficult economic times and we urge customers to check out our call rates and what is included in the $300 cap value."

TPG will continue to re-set the bar for affordable mobile deals, starting with a mobile cap plan with $550 of included value priced at only $39.99 per month. Visit TPG Mobile Products website for more details.

About TPG
   
TPG merged with Australian publicly listed company SP Telemedia (ASX code: SOT) in April 2008 and is a full service telecommunications provider, delivering ADSL and ADSL2+ Broadband, Mobile, Fixed Line voice telephony services, Data Networking solutions and more to Australian homes and businesses.

TPG is the winner of PC Magazine's 2007 Best Value Standard Broadband Plan, Money Magazine's 2008 Best Broadband Plan - High Speed, and Money Magazine's 2008 Best Home VoIP Service.

TPG is able to provide the Corporate, Government and Wholesale customers with an extensive telecommunications product set by means of the company's Australia-wide converged voice, data and video IP network.
